Teachers Expected To Launch Legal Action

Legal action is expected today from public school teachers
challenging provincial legislation imposing a contract and taking away their right to strike for two years.
A news conference is planned for today outside a Toronto court where the unions representing teachers and school support workers will discuss their legal move.
Education Minister Laurel Broten says the government believe the legislation will withstand the constitutional challenge.
The New Democrats predict the wage freeze bill will be struck down by the courts and will cost Ontario taxpayers more in the long run.
